One Pot Lebanese-Style Spiced Lamb & Rice
You can whip up this Lebanese classic using just one pot. You'll brown lamb mince with coriander and paprika before adding rice and simmering the lot in a rich stock. Stir through spinach and serve on a bed of creamy yoghurt to finish.

Cooking instructions
Instructions for 2 [for 3] [for 4] portion recipe.
Heat a pot (with a matching lid) over a high heat with a drizzle of olive oil
Once hot, add your lamb mince and a generous pinch of salt and pepper
Cook for 4-5 min or until beginning to brown, breaking it up with a wooden spoon as you go

Peel and finely dice your red onion[s]

Once browned, add the diced onion with your ground coriander and ground paprika and cook for 2 min or until fragrant

Once fragrant, add your white long grain rice and beef stock mix with 350ml [530ml] [700ml] cold water and bring to the boil over a high heat
Once boiling, reduce the heat to very low and cook, covered, for 12-15 min or until all the water has absorbed and the rice and lamb mince is cooked through (no pink meat!)

Wash your spinach and pat it dry with kitchen paper

Once your rice has cooked, remove from the heat and add your spinach
Put the lid back on and set aside for 4-6 min or until the spinach has started to wilt
Give everything a good mix up – this is your one pot Lebanese-style spiced lamb & rice

Strip your mint from their stems and chop them roughly, discard the stems
Tip: Hold the top of the herb sprigs firmly and slide your fingers down their lengths to easily remove the leaves

Serve the one pot Lebanese-style spiced lamb & rice and drizzle over your natural yoghurt
Garnish with the chopped mint and a good grind of black pepper
